Buying entity๐Ÿ‡ฌ๐Ÿ‡ง Department for Communities and Local Government Buying unitnot reported Publication date2014-04-19 Contest statusnot reported DescriptionDCLG is the lead Government department for assessing the risks to the built environment in the UK from earthquakes responding to their consequences and helping communities recover should a serious one occur. In order to do this, DCLG needs access to specialist advice as part of the Government's risk assessment process and immediate advice on the impacts of earthquakes as soon as they happen. As this service is not available within DCLG's own staff, a contract to provide the department with a specialist seismic monitoring and information service has been awarded.

This award was granted to British Geological Survey by Department for Communities and Local Government for an amount of GBP 137,437. The procurement process was conducted through open for the category of services. The award was granted on 2015-07-14. This is award number 1.
